Understanding the Types of Stationary Bikes
Stationary bikes typically fall into 3 main categories, each dealing with various user preferences and workout styles.
Type of Stationary BikeDescriptionIdeal UserUpright BikeThis bike resembles a standard bicycle for exercise at home, with users sitting upright. It offers an intense exercise bikes for sale concentrating on cardiovascular endurance, leg strength, and lower body toning.Beginners to advanced cyclists looking for a challenging workout.Recumbent BikeIncluding a reclined seat, recumbent bikes disperse weight uniformly and support the back. This position makes for a comfortable ride while engaging the lower body efficiently.People with back problems, elderly users, or those looking for a lower-impact workout.Spin BikeSpin bikes are developed for high-intensity interval training (HIIT) and simulated road biking. Stationary bikes load various benefits, making them an enticing choice for fitness fans. Here are some necessary advantages:

Cardiovascular Health: Regular biking improves heart health by increasing cardiovascular endurance. It promotes better blood circulation and reinforces the heart muscle.

Weight Loss and Management: Using a stationary bike burns calories, helping people to shed excess weight and keep a healthy body structure when integrated with a balanced diet.

Versatility and Variety in Workouts: Most stationary bikes offer different resistance levels and exercise programs, allowing users to customize their sessions according to personal fitness objectives.

Muscle Toning: Cycling targets significant muscle groups in the legs, including the quadriceps, hamstrings, and calves. Gradually, this can cause enhanced muscle meaning and strength.
Secret Features to Look for When Buying a Stationary Bike
When considering the purchase of a stationary bike, it is essential to prioritize certain features to ensure a gratifying and reliable workout experience. Here are some key elements to take into account:

Adjustability: Look for a bike with adjustable seats and handlebars to accommodate various body sizes and make sure convenience during usage.

Resistance Levels: Opt for a bike that offers a vast array of resistance settings, allowing for progressive strength increases as fitness levels enhance.

Integrated Programs: Many bikes feature pre-set exercise programs that assist users through regimens, supplying range and inspiration.

Display and Connectivity: A good display screen ought to track metrics such as speed, distance, calories burned, and time. Think about bikes that can link to mobile apps or have Bluetooth capability for additional engagement.

Weight Capacity: Ensure the bike can support your weight for ideal security and performance. Many bikes note their maximum weight limit in the requirements.

Stability and Build Quality: A sturdy frame and strong construction are needed for attaining a comfortable and safe cycling experience, specifically when pressing towards higher resistance levels.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)1. How frequently should I utilize a stationary bicycle for optimal outcomes?
For best outcomes, goal for a minimum of 150 minutes of moderate aerobic activity or 75 minutes of vigorous activity each week, spread out across numerous days.
2. Can I lose weight on a stationary bike?
Yes, when integrated with a balanced diet plan, biking can be a reliable methods of burning calories and losing weight.
3. Is cycling on a stationary bike bad for my knees?
No, stationary biking is a low-impact exercise that minimizes strain on the knees. However, it is suggested to maintain proper form and change the seat height correctly to avoid any undue tension.
4. Can you develop muscle with a stationary bike?
While the primary advantage of stationary bikes is cardiovascular fitness, routine use can help tone and strengthen the muscles of the legs and lower body.
5. Are stationary bicycles ideal for elders?
Yes, they are an outstanding option for senior citizens, as they supply low-impact exercises that support cardiovascular health while being much easier on the joints.
6. How much should I invest in a stationary bicycle?
Rates can differ commonly based on features, brand name, and quality. Anticipate to invest anywhere from ₤ 200 to ₤ 2,000. Set your budget plan according to your needs and designated use.
